LIFE, Rolo Tomassi and Crazy Arm are just some of the most recent additions to this year’s 2000trees line-up.
Frank Turner has also been confirmed as a headliner for the event - plus, he’ll be playing with his other project Möngöl Hörde, too.
These acts join the likes of You Me At Six, Every Time I Die, While She Sleeps and Frank Iero and the Future Violents, who’ll also be appearing at the Cheltenham-based weekender.
This year’s edition of the 2000trees takes place from Thursday 11th July, to Saturday 13th July, at Gloucestershire’s Upcote Farm.
The full list of news additions to the line-up is as follows.
Frank Turner / Möngöl Hörde / Skinny Lister / Rolo Tomassi / WSTR / LIFE / Petrol Girls / The St. Pierre Snake Invasion / Jim Lockey & The Solemn Sun / Crazy Arm / Sean McGowan / Oxygen Thief / Johnny Lloyd / Brand New Friend / Deux Furieuses / Grace Petrie
